To study the effect of abrasive flow polishing on internal surface of heteromorphic coelomopore and polishing deburring of micro-holes
the function relationship between each technological parameter of abrasive flow and processing quality in the process of polishing was discussed. Common rail pipe that is a type of non-straight pipe was taken as research object
and numerical simulation study was implemented for abrasive flow polishing process
the influence of each technological parameter on abrasive flow polishing was explored. Numerical simulation results show that: the viscosity-temperature characteristics in the process of abrasive flow polishing can be changed by controlling volume fraction of SiC
thus the control of quality for abrasive flow polishing can be realized. Then orthogonal method was adopted to design experiment scheme. Changed data of temperature and viscosity in polishing process was collected and influence of viscosity-temperature characteristics on quality of abrasive flow polishing was analyzed. The experimental and numerical simulation results show that the range rank of SiC volume fraction is higher than that of exit pressure in the process of abrasive flow polishing. What's more significant is the quality of work-piece surface can be effectively improved by abrasive flow polishing. Under the condition of the experiment
the exit pressure of the optimum technology parameter for common rail tube of abrasive flow polishing is 5 MPa; the volume fraction of SiC is 0.25%; the mesh number of SiC is 80; the regression equation of surface roughness and volume fraction can be obtained at the same time
which can be applied to guide production of practical polishing for abrasive flow.
